发明名称 Multi-exposure video
摘要 Certain cameras and systems described herein produce enhanced dynamic range still or video images. The images can also have controlled or reduced motion artifacts. Moreover, the cameras and systems in some cases allow the dynamic range and/or motion artifacts to be tuned to achieve a desired cinematic effect.

主权项 1. A method of obtaining video image data using a digital image sensor, the method comprising: for successive frames of video image data, controlling a digital image sensor to begin capturing a first image at a first exposure level according to a rolling shutter technique in which successive groups of pixels of the image sensor are exposed and read out in successive, overlapping time slots; and subsequent to a starting group of the groups of pixels completing exposure for the first image, and prior to an ending group of the groups of pixels completing exposure for the first image, controlling the digital image sensor to begin capturing a second image at a second exposure level different than the first exposure level according to the rolling shutter technique, wherein said controlling the digital image sensor to begin capturing the second image includes allowing each respective group of pixels to complete capturing the light corresponding to the first image prior to controlling that respective group of pixels to begin capturing the light corresponding to the second image, and wherein the amount of time that elapses from between completion of readout of digital measurements corresponding to the starting group for the first image to the beginning of readout of digital measurements corresponding to the starting group for second image is greater than the amount of time that elapses from between completing readout of the digital measurements corresponding to the starting group for the first image to substantially completing readout of digital measurements for the entire first image.
